Universal Banker Management Trainee - Branch Banking
Central Pacific Bank
Position Function: Universal Banker Leadership Development Program positions combine the core sales, service, operational, and risk‑management responsibilities of a Universal Banker with a structured development path toward future branch leadership role. Incumbents deliver an exceptional customer experience, build and retain customer relationships, identify customer banking needs, cross‑sell appropriate products and services, and refer customers to business partners and specialists, as appropriate. They are responsible for meeting assigned operational, sales, service, referral, and risk‑management goals while supporting the overall success of the branch. Incumbents open consumer and business deposit products; accept and close secured and unsecured consumer and scored business loan and line of credit applications; and may be certified to accept and close home equity lines of credit and loans, as applicable. In addition to performing Universal Banker responsibilities, participants in this program complete formal training, on‑the‑job training, mentoring, coaching, developmental branch assignments, department rotations, and certification‑based progression designed to prepare them for future Assistant Manager opportunities. The program curriculum is generally designed to be completed within approximately 18 to 30 months, depending on the participant’s experience, demonstrated proficiency, performance, and available placement opportunities. Progression through Levels I, II, and III reflects increasing capability, independence, complexity of work, and leadership readiness. Level I focuses on foundational teller, new account, service, and relationship‑building skills. Level II expands into broader product knowledge, credit‑related exposure, branch operations, and developmental leadership exposure. Level III emphasizes advanced operational capability, team leadership, branch balancing/open‑close responsibilities, problem resolution, coaching support, and readiness for placement into an Assistant Manager role.
